Monitor and proctor online exams ... Webb29 juni 2024 · Google penalizes websites it finds with content that’s over 10% plagiarized. Getting a penalty for plagiarism harms your SERP ranking, and in extreme cases, Google may remove your website from the list. There are four degrees of penalties: Keyword-level penalties: Keyword penalties only affect your ranking for a specific keyword.

Webb1 juni 2011 · The possible consequences of plagiarism enumerated by certain authors are as follows: 1.) give verbal and written warnings, ask to rewrite and resubmit paper, give … Webb24 nov. 2024 · One measure of access – students’ awareness of the penalties applied for plagiarism and academic dishonesty – did not reflect the relative power distance scores between nations. The highest proportion (70%) of students in Czechia said that they were aware of penalties applied, whereas in the UK the proportion was lower (60%).
